Agency Producer Fees

 

The Agency will receive an agency producer fee for services rendered. The Service Provider will pay this fee directly to the Agency.  The agent producer fee is determined by a graduated agency producer fee scale as follows:

8% on the first $1,000 of premium
5% on the next $4,000 of premium
3% on the next $95,000 of premium
2% on premium in excess of $100,000

The agency producer fee is paid on standard premium exclusive of any surcharges and the flat fee.

The agency producer fee is paid on both the original policy and on each subsequent renewal. The Agency is not to deduct the agency producer fee when sending in the deposit and advance premiums or a payment. The Service Provider will pay the agency producer fee by sending a check.

Agency producer fee checks will only be made payable to the Agency.  Only one Agency and one Designated Producer for each Policyholder can be recognized by the Service Provider at any one time. This will be the Agency identified on the original Application for Coverage and the Designated Producer who signed the original FWCJUA Application for Coverage, unless a change is properly requested by the Policyholder.  Please refer to the Policy Change Procedures, Change of Agency and/or Designated Producer found in the Agency and Designated Producers section of the FWCJUA Operations Manual.

If an overpayment of premium occurs due to an overestimate of exposures as determined on audit, or because of a reduction in the experience modification or some other reason, any excess agency producer fee paid by the Service Provider is to be returned by the Agency. The agency producer fee is to be paid by the Service Provider within thirty (30) calendar days from the premium payment.

As to any additional audit premium billing, no agency producer fee on the additional audit premium will be paid to the Agency if such premium is not received by the Service Provider within sixty (60) calendar days from the billing date.
